Description
INTRODUCTION
Offered with no forward chain, this four bedroom detached house would make an ideal family home. Accommodation briefly comprises an entrance porch opening into the entrance hall, a shower room, a 28ft lounge/diner, a fitted kitchen and a conservatory on the ground floor. The first floor benefits from four bedrooms and a fitted family bathroom. Additional benefits include off road parking to the front, an integral garage and an enclosed rear garden.
LOCATION
Bitterne has a thriving centre that offers a broad range of shops and general amenities along with its own infant, junior and senior schools and train station. Southampton’s city centre with its broad range of shops including WestQuay shopping centre, its bars, restaurants, cinemas, amenities and mainline railway station is within easy reach. Southampton Airport is around twenty minutes away and all main motorway access routes are also close by, including M27 links east and west bound via M3 to M25 and via A3 to London.
